How much does a directors, religious activities and education make in Utah?

The median directors, religious activities and education salary in Utah is $56,790 per year ($27.3/hr). This is 9% above the national median of $52,100. Salaries range from $30,050 to $81,960.

Can a directors, religious activities and education afford to live in Utah?

At the median salary of $56,790, a directors, religious activities and education in Utah would take home approximately $3,752/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$2,044/month, that's 54.5%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
